Aurelian Radoaca (aurelian2403) wrote : Re: [Bug 673431] Re: [gm45] 'Cannot update ICEauthority' message on login
Download full text (3.3 KiB)

.ICEauthority and a few other files in the Home folder were owned by root.
I did not see the problem lately. It can be solved, if it reappears, by
changing the owner of everything in the Home folder to the user:
sudo chown user:user -R ~/*
